Native Trails 3.5" Disposer Trim w/Basket Strainer Drain Gunmetal, Brass, DR340-GM

The 3.5" Basket Strainer with Disposer Trim from Native Trails is engineered to last, with sturdy construction and high quality finishes. Designed for use with ISE type disposer units, this kitchen sink strainer is available in finishes that perfectly coordinate with Native Trails' hand hammered copper, nickel and NativeStone kitchen and bar sinks.

Features


  • NEW Gunmetal Finish!
  • Fits most ISE type disposer units (InSinkErator, KitchenAid)
  • Features spring-loaded center post for a tight seal
  • High quality finish will resist rust and corrosion through everyday use
  • All hardware required for installation is included
  • Covered under Native Trails one year warranty
